Former security provider’s fine increased to $12,500

A former security provider has been fined $12,500 for working without a licence.

On 23 July 2008, Christopher Wayne Hall was convicted in the Brisbane Magistrates Court of 23 charges of working as a security provider without holding an appropriate licence under the Security Providers Act. He was fined $5000.

The Office of Fair Trading appealed the fine and on 13 July 2009, Hall’s fine was increased to $12,500 in the Brisbane District Court.

Minister for Fair Trading Peter Lawlor said the penalties for operating as an unlicensed security provider had increased substantially in July 2007

“The prosecution of Christopher Hall was the first to be heard in court following the increase in penalties in July 2007,” Mr Lawlor said.

“Working as an unlicensed security provider is a serious offence and I believe this new fine is an indication of just how seriously the courts treat breaches of the Security Providers Act.”

Christopher Hall’s security provider’s licence was cancelled after he was convicted of possession of a prohibited import in 2004. He had been found in possession of stun guns.

In August 2007 Office of Fair Trading inspectors carried out security provider’s compliance checks at a Brisbane shopping centre and found Mr Hall working as a security guard and directed him to cease.

One month later inspectors again made checks at the shopping centre and found Mr Hall had continued to work on 23 occasions following his initial warning.

“Working as a security provider carries a high level of responsibility and unprofessional behaviour will not be tolerated,” Mr Lawlor said.

“That’s why there are very high penalties for anyone found breaching the Security Providers Act,” he said.
